Font Awesome Icon Picker form widget for Contao CMS

DCA

Use the fontawesomeIconPicker input type to add the Font Awesome Icon Picker form widget to your tl_content table.

$GLOBALS['TL_DCA']['tl_content']['fields']['serviceLinkFaIcon'] = [
    'exclude'   => true,
    'search'    => true,
    'inputType' => 'fontawesomeIconPicker',
    'eval'      => ['doNotShow' => true],
    'sql'       => 'blob NULL',
];

Configuration

Out of the box, the bundle uses the free version of Font Awesome and does not require any configuration. But you can also use the Pro version by changing the configuration in your config/config.yaml file.

markocupic_fontawesome_icon_picker:
  # Use your custom Font Awesome (Pro) version here:
  fontawesome_source_path: 'files/fontawesome-pro/js/all.min.js' # You can even use the url to your kit 'https://kit.fontawesome.com/12345sdf65.js
  # Set the version of Font Awesome you want to use.
  fontawesome_version: '7.0.1'
  # Set the allowed styles
  fontawesome_allowed_styles:
    - fa-solid
    - fa-regular
    - fa-light
    - fa-brands
    - fa-duotone
    - fa-thin
  # Add the path to your custom fontawesome icons meta file.
  fontawesome_meta_file_path: 'files/fontawesome-pro/metadata/icons.yml'

Frontend usage

This extension will not add Font Awesome to your frontend. You have to add it yourself in your layout.
